What Exactly is 'Rotation Sogaeting' and How Does it Work?

These modern speed dating events are far from the chaotic college mixers of the past. They are usually hosted in stylish, privately rented cafes, quiet pubs, or elegant hotel lounges across major cities like Seoul.

  • The Crowd & Verification: Events are carefully curated to ensure an even gender ratio, typically accommodating anywhere from 8 to 32 total participants. One of the most significant advantages is the strict emphasis on safety and reliability. Organizers require participants to verify their identity, age, and occupation (often via employment certificates or business cards) before joining.
  • Cost & Duration: A standard event lasts about 2 to 3 hours. The participation fee generally ranges from 20,000 KRW to 70,000 KRW (approximately $15 to $50 USD) depending on gender and the scale of the event. Considering the high cost of dinner and drinks on a regular blind date, many singles find this an incredibly cost-effective investment.
  • The Rotation Process: Participants are given pre-filled profile cards detailing basic information, personality types (MBTI), hobbies, and dating preferences. You sit across from someone and chat for about 10 to 15 minutes. Once the bell rings, it is time to rotate seats! At the end of the event, you discreetly submit the numbers of the people you liked. The host will notify you privately if there is a mutual match, saving everyone from face-to-face rejections.

Real Reviews: The Good, The Bad, and The Honest

Looking at reviews from real participants reveals a very balanced picture of what you can expect.

The Pros: High Efficiency and Zero Pressure Participants consistently rave about the practicality of these events. Instead of spending weeks texting a stranger from an app only to realize there is no physical chemistry, you can filter through a dozen people in a single evening. Furthermore, because there are no mutual acquaintances involved, you completely avoid the guilt and awkwardness of having to politely reject someone. It is widely considered the ultimate efficient approach to modern dating.

The Cons: The 'Conveyor Belt' Fatigue However, it is not a perfect system. Many attendees warn about the infamous 'conveyor belt sushi' feeling. When you only have 10 minutes, conversations can easily become repetitive and superficial. Repeating your job title and neighborhood over and over in one night can be mentally draining. Some singles report experiencing a severe drop in their social battery by the final rotation, making it difficult to form deep, meaningful connections on the spot.

How to Stand Out and Get Matched (Success Tips)

To beat the repetitive nature of speed dating and actually secure a match, you need a solid strategy. Here are practical, actionable tips to elevate your experience:

  1. Dress to Impress: The 10-Minute Halo Effect When time is highly restricted, your visual presentation speaks volumes. Opt for clean, polished, and approachable attire—think smart casual or a neat first-date outfit. A warm, genuine smile is your best accessory to instantly disarm any awkwardness.
  2. Ditch the Boring Interview Questions Do not be the tenth person to ask them what their job is. Look at their profile card and ask something engaging! Try questions like, 'What is a movie you recently watched that left a lasting impression on you?' or 'If you had a completely free Saturday, what is the very first thing you would do?' Unique questions create emotional spikes and make you highly memorable.
  3. Take Notes and Manage Your Energy After meeting multiple people back-to-back, faces and names will inevitably blur together. Use the brief intervals between rotations to quickly jot down a defining characteristic or a shared interest on your scorecard. Also, pace yourself. Treat the evening like a marathon, not a sprint, ensuring you save enough energy to give your final date the exact same enthusiasm as your first.

Speed Dating vs. Other Options

  • Dating Apps: Highly accessible and inexpensive, but they often lack sincerity and require extensive vetting. Ghosting is common, and moving from text to real life is a hurdle.
  • Matchmaking Agencies: These can cost thousands of dollars but offer highly curated, background-checked introductions. They are excellent for those strictly focused on immediate marriage but can feel too rigid for casual dating.
  • Speed Dating / Rotation Parties: This format strikes the perfect middle ground. For about $30-$50, you get the physical safety of verified participants, the high-volume efficiency of apps, and the genuine face-to-face connection of traditional blind dates.
